About Patent Law in Orange Park, United States

Patent law in Orange Park, United States is a specialized field that deals with the protection of intellectual property. A patent grants the inventor exclusive rights to their invention for a certain period of time. These rights include the ability to prevent others from making, using, or selling the patented invention without permission.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is a patent?

A patent is a legal protection granted by the government to inventors, giving them exclusive rights to their invention for a certain period of time.

2. How do I apply for a patent?

To apply for a patent, you must file a patent application with the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) and meet certain requirements, including disclosing the invention in detail.

3. How long does a patent last?

A utility patent lasts for 20 years from the date of filing, while a design patent lasts for 15 years from the date of grant.

4. What can be patented?

To be eligible for a patent, an invention must be novel, non-obvious, and useful. This can include processes, machines, compositions of matter, or designs.

5. What rights does a patent grant?

A patent grants the inventor the exclusive right to make, use, and sell their invention for a certain period of time, typically 20 years from the date of filing.

6. What is patent infringement?

Patent infringement occurs when someone makes, uses, sells, or imports a patented invention without permission from the patent holder.

7. How can a lawyer help with patent infringement?

A lawyer can help the patent holder take legal action against infringers, seek damages, and defend their patent rights in court.

8. Can I license my patent to others?

Yes, a patent holder can license their patent to others, allowing them to make, use, or sell the patented invention in exchange for royalties or other compensation.
